Harold Brittain Champions: Aldergrove Kodiaks
On November 30, the Aldergrove Kodiaks travelled to Ridge Meadows to face the Flames. They were at exactly the mid point of their regular season schedule. The Kodiaks were in a close race with the Flames for second place in the Harold Brittain Conference standings with a record of 10-11-1. They defeated Ridge Meadows that night by a score of 4-1 and then reeled off ten victories in a row, going undefeated in December. After eliminating the first placed Abbotsford Pilots last night, the Kodiaks have an astonishing record of 26-6-0 since that game in November. The Conference Final was closer than the 4-1 series score would indicate, but Aldergrove found a way to defeat a very strong and determined Abbotsford squad. They will now enjoy a few days rest and wait to see what the Tom Shaw Conference has in store for them. After their incredible mid-season turn-around, and two hard-fought playoff series victories, the Kodiaks will go into the PJHL Finals riding a wave of momentum. It will not be an easy task, no matter who they face in the Finals, but the Kodiaks are on a roll, and they have to feel good about their chances.
